Course
Curriculum:
1st
& 2nd month
-
Learning
Indirect
Ophthalmoscopy
and scleral
indentation
Diagnosis
and planning
management
of OPD cases
3rd
month
- Learning
diagnostics
Ultrasound/FFA/OCT
4th
month
- Lasers
(indirect
laser ophthalmoscopy)
During
the fellowship
• To conduct
one clinical study
during the fellowship
• To write
one article for
publication
• To make
presentations
in the retina
classes
Rotation
This
is a flexible
program. Depending
on the requirement,
the Fellow will
be on rotation
with particular
faculty members,
and will also
have opportunities
to undertake short-term
project work.
